True petrolheads will certainly know that some years ago debuted the Holy Trio of the Hypercars
Ferrari Laferrari, McLaren P1 and Porsche 918 Spyder

Aesthetically it has lots of details from its predecessor
The rival to the Ferrari Enzo: the Porsche Carrera GT
They look very similar, a convex design settled on the ground
It looks like a cloud with 4 wheels
It has some crazy aerodynamic features
This very 918 Spyder has the Weissach Package
With carbon fiber aerodynamic details in the front and in the back
Let's get a little closer
If you saw our video test drive with the Panamera Sport Turismo E-Hybrid from a couple of weeks ago
You'll remember we talked about the Porsche Hybrid technologies
Well: it all started from here
This hypercar has a V8 petrol engine and an electric one, that combined provide 893HP
A tremendous amount!
It has some lime green details all around, such as this E-Hybrid badge on the side
Lime green brake calipers too
Inside too, we'll take a look later, there are lime green details
Then the back: that's the part that reminds me the Carrera GT the most
Aerodynamic lower bits in carbon fiber
This massive spoiler
It lifts up in Race Mode
Here's another detail in lime green, the ''918 Spyder'' badge
But the most beautiful part of the car, in my opinion
Is this one
The engine bay with the two upper exhausts tips
Then there's this concave back part of the roof, which reminds the shape of the seats inside
And this is also the part in which the 918 Spyder reminds me of the Carrera GT
A wonderful heritage in a wonderful car

Inside it has more heritage from the Carrera GT
This central tunnel, similar to the one of the Carrera GT
It had the gear lever with a wooden tip
Technology went on since that car, so now there's a touch screen
With many touch buttons
Right here another screen
And in front of me the wonder
It is a wonder!
Central line in lime green
Such as the trims on the seats
And this steering wheel
It is perfect
Here's the Porsche rotor
With many driving modes: there's E
Which stands for E-Hybrid...
No, forgive me, E stands for Electric Mode, there's the H for Hybrid, I'm too emotional right now
Then there's Sport Mode
But here there's no Sport Plus, here's an R: Race Mode
A monster with 893 HP and 1275 NM of torque
